Compare the rivalry schools - University of Massachusetts-Dartmouth and Williams College.

University of Massachusetts-Dartmouth (UMass Dartmouth) is a Public, 4-years school located in North Dartmouth, MA and Williams College is a Private, 4-years school located in Williamstown, MA. Following list and table compares two rivalry schools in various academic factors.
  • Williams College has higher submitted SAT score (1,530) than University of Massachusetts-Dartmouth (1,140).
  • Williams College (8.50% acceptance rate) is tighter than University of Massachusetts-Dartmouth (95.52% acceptance rate) to get in.
  • University of Massachusetts-Dartmouth (7,457 students) is larger than Williams College (2,222 students).
  • Williams College has more expensive tuition & fees of $64,860 than University of Massachusetts-Dartmouth($31,750).
  • University of Massachusetts-Dartmouth has more full-time faculties of 397 faculties than Williams College(317 facluties).
